About The Position

This is a grant-funded position ending September 2027, supporting the FY22 Choice Neighborhood Implementation Grant. The role involves organizing and directing wellness, behavioral health, and care navigation services for diverse populations in low-income and affordable housing. Key responsibilities include connecting clients with local medical and wellness resources, coordinating wellness programming across multiple public housing sites, and facilitating access to preventive and supportive services. The position also requires partnering with the City of Tucson Housing and Community Development Resident Services team to coordinate healthy lifestyle programming and connect individuals to community resources like food banks. The goal is to assist clients in achieving their care plan goals, thereby improving individual health outcomes and strengthening community wellness.
